[ruby-core:63042] [ruby-trunk - Bug #9922] Compiling Ruby 1.9.3p194 from source code with openssl crashe

From: usa@...
Date: 2014-06-10 05:34:04 UTC
List: ruby-core #63042
Issue #9922 has been updated by Usaku NAKAMURA.


I have not been able to reproduce this problem at this time.
From the information that is provided by you, I can not debug unfortunately.

It should be noted, ruby =E2=80=8B=E2=80=8B1.9.3 has ended the normal maint=
enance phase already,
we do not plan to release bug fixes without security issues.
If possible, please check ruby 2.1 or 2.0.0, and report if the problem stil=
l occurs.

----------------------------------------
Bug #9922: Compiling Ruby 1.9.3p194 from source code with openssl crashe
https://bugs.ruby-lang.org/issues/9922#change-47122

* Author: Pooja Saxena
* Status: Feedback
* Priority: Normal
* Assignee:=20
* Category:=20
* Target version:=20
* ruby -v:  ruby 1.9.3p194 (2012-04-20 revision 35410) [i386-mswin32_90]
* Backport: 1.9.3: UNKNOWN, 2.1: UNKNOWN
----------------------------------------
Hi,

I am trying to compile ruby from source code. And i am using thin server. P=
roblem is when i am trying to start thin with ssl option by specifying :-

ruby bin/thin --ssl -a 127.0.0.1 -p 44466 start

I starts the server, but on accessing the https://localhost:44466. It crash=
es ruby and gives the error on console and a popup comes saying ruby interp=
retor has stopped working.

"This application has requested the Runtime to terminate it in an unusual w=
ay. Please contact the application's support team for more information."

and in windows even logs i see :--

Faulting application name: ruby.exe, version: 1.9.3.194, time stamp: 0x5154=
804d
Faulting module name: MSVCR90.dll, version: 9.0.30729.4940, time stamp: 0x4=
ca2ef57
Exception code: 0x40000015
Fault offset: 0x0005beae
Faulting process id: 0x11d4
Faulting application start time: 0x01cf7fb6cca849aa
Faulting application path: C:\Ruby19\bin\ruby.exe
Faulting module path: C:\Windows\WinSx\x86_microsoft.vc90.crt_1fc8b3b9a1e18=
e3b_9.0.30729.4940_none_50916076bcb9a742\MSVCR90.dll
Report Id: 47c368b9-ebaa-11e3-8cd8-8c89a5d53bc0`

I've compiled ruby with diff versions of openssl, but same application cras=
h error. I am on windows platform and compiliing using microsoft visual stu=
dio8. Please let me know if i am missing some steps. how can remove/avoid t=
his 'msvcr90.dll' error.

platform :- windows7
compiler :- Microsoft visual studio9
Ruby :- ruby1.9.3p194
Openssl :- openssl 1.0.0d/openssl 1.0.0e

---Files--------------------------------
scrreshot ruby crash.png (32.7 KB)


--=20
https://bugs.ruby-lang.org/

In This Thread

Prev Next